Abstract
⺠Pre-ischemic and post-ischemic PACE conditioning against IRI in a rat cremaster muscle flap model. ⺠PACE conditioning improves microcirculatory hemodynamics. ⺠PACE conditioning increases expression of proangiogenic factors: VEGF and vWF. ⺠PACE postconditioning inhibits expression of iNOS and inflammatory chemokines (CCL2, CXCL5).
